然而,许多企业和个人用户在使用远程服务器时,常常遭遇一个令人头疼的问题:软件打开速度缓慢
这一问题不仅影响了工作效率,还可能对业务连续性和用户体验造成严重影响
本文将从多个角度深入分析远程服务器打开软件慢的原因,并提出一系列切实可行的解决方案,旨在帮助用户彻底摆脱这一困扰
一、远程服务器软件打开慢的现象与影响 远程服务器软件打开慢的现象通常表现为:点击应用程序图标后,需要等待较长时间才能看到程序界面;在打开大型软件或复杂应用时,延迟尤为明显;有时甚至出现程序无响应或崩溃的情况
这些问题不仅影响了用户的操作体验,还可能导致数据丢失、业务中断等严重后果
对于依赖远程服务器进行日常工作的员工而言,软件打开慢意味着他们需要花费更多时间等待,从而降低了工作效率
对于提供在线服务的企业而言,软件响应迟缓可能导致客户满意度下降,甚至引发客户投诉和流失
此外,长时间的等待还可能增加服务器的负载,加速硬件老化,增加维护成本
二、原因分析 2.1 网络延迟与带宽不足 远程服务器与客户端之间的数据传输依赖于网络
网络延迟和带宽不足是导致软件打开慢的主要原因之一
当网络拥堵或带宽被其他任务占用时,数据传输速度会显著下降,从而影响软件的加载速度
2.2 服务器性能瓶颈 服务器硬件配置、操作系统优化以及正在运行的服务和进程数量都会影响其性能
如果服务器CPU、内存或磁盘I/O等资源紧张,软件打开时就会因为资源分配不足而变慢
2.3 应用程序优化不足 部分应用程序在开发时未充分考虑远程环境下的性能需求,导致在远程服务器上运行时效率低下
此外,应用程序的更新和维护也可能引入新的性能问题
2.4 数据存储与访问策略 数据在远程服务器上的存储方式、访问权限设置以及缓存策略都会影响软件的加载速度
如果数据存储分散、访问权限复杂或缓存策略不合理,软件在打开时需要花费更多时间进行数据检索和权限验证
2.5 远程桌面协议限制 远程桌面协议(如RDP、VNC等)在传输图像和数据时存在一定的性能损耗
如果协议设置不当或版本过旧,会进一步加剧软件打开慢的问题
三、解决方案 3.1 优化网络连接 - 升级网络设备:确保网络设备(如路由器、交换机)具备足够的处理能力和带宽,以支持高效的数据传输
- 使用专用网络:考虑建立VPN或专用网络,以减少网络拥堵和延迟
- 流量管理:通过流量管理策略,确保关键应用的数据传输优先级,避免带宽被其他非关键任务占用
3.2 提升服务器性能 - 硬件升级:根据实际需求,增加服务器CPU、内存和磁盘容量,提升整体性能
- 操作系统优化:定期更新操作系统补丁,关闭不必要的服务和进程,减少资源占用
- 负载均衡:在服务器上部署负载均衡器,将请求分发到多个服务器上,减轻单一服务器的压力
3.3 优化应用程序 - 代码优化:对应用程序进行代码级别的优化,提高运行效率
- 更新与升级:及时更新应用程序版本,以修复已知的性能问题和安全漏洞
- 配置调整:根据远程服务器的实际情况,调整应用程序的配置参数,如内存分配、缓存大小等
3.4 优化数据存储与访问策略 - 数据集中存储:将相关数据集中存储在性能较高的磁盘上,减少数据检索时间
- 简化访问权限:合理设置数据访问权限,避免复杂的权限验证过程
- 智能缓存:利用缓存技术,将常用数据存储在内存中,加快数据访问速度
3.5 改进远程桌面协议 - 升级协议版本:使用最新版本的远程桌面协议,以获得更好的性能和兼容性
- 调整协议设置:根据实际需求,调整远程桌面协议的设置,如图像质量、分辨率等,以减少数据传输量
- 使用更高效的协议:考虑使用如TeamViewer、AnyDesk等更高效的远程桌面解决方案,以替代传统的RDP或VNC协议
四、实施效果与后续维护 通过